Security agents in Maiduguri, Borno State have reportedly arrested a suspected female suicide bomber, authorities say.
The suspect, an old woman, was caught at the General Shuwa Memorial Hospital in the state capital with a bomb hidden inside a food flask, Guardian reports.
The
woman was said to have entered the hospital premises at about 11:35 am
on Thursday, December 4, disguised as a patient’s relative.
She was stopped for a search at the gate but reportedly refused to open one of the flasks she was carrying.
A guard at the hospital is said to have stated:
“When
she was asked to open the other flask, she refused, swearing that she
will not open it. Our security guards have to call the soldiers at a
military post to ascertain whether or not the flask contains any
explosive.”
“Three minutes after, the
bomb detector beeped for some seconds, indicating the presence of an
explosive device, and the old woman was immediately whisked away by the
military personnel to an unknown destination for further interrogation
and investigation,” he added.
